1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does |2x+1| = 7 mean?

Back

2x+1 = 7 or 2x+1 = -7

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Solve the equation |x-1| + 2 = 10.

Back

x = 9 or x = -7

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the solution to |2x + 1| = 5?

Back

x = 2 or x = -3

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Solve the equation |x+10| = 11.

Back

x = 1 or x = -21

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

If we solve |5x| = 40, what do we get?

Back

x = 8 or x = -8

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define absolute value.

Back

The absolute value of a number is its distance from zero on the number line, regardless of direction.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the general form of an absolute value equation?

Back

|A| = B can be expressed as A = B or A = -B.
